Alpine.js
FrameworksAlpine.js is a rugged, minimal framework for composing behavior directly in your markup. It provides a declarative, reactive, and composable way to build user interfaces with JavaScript, often used as a lighter alternative to larger frameworks like Vue.js or React for simpler projects.
Twitter Flight
FrameworksTwitter Flight is a lightweight, component-based JavaScript framework for building web applications.
